FREQUENT CONCERNS AND ISSUES

-- Rule of 301, if your bottom (last) ritual has less than 301 VE in it because it was set low, or the creatures are wounded, the computer will randomize your defense. If you set a single barren soul on defense more than once, you get what you deserve.

-- Getting better stats, ve, and vp. These all go up daily, and as a result of fights, and from sacrificing creatures. The more upgrades a creature has, the more you get from it, so wait as long as you can.

-- Regeneration rituals – the hint on the marquee really means HEALING rituals that restore creature Vital Energy, and have nothing to do with the regeneration creature function, which you will hear talked about all the time by mp5's (only) who are trying to reduce xp.

-- GGG, the Golden Globe Gazebo is a special place with special rules, to train creatures without capping player xp. You should be exploring enough to find this on your own. (Actually, it was, read about it in MD forum, personal note).

-- Getting higher max AP only happens by adopting a homeland or joining an alliance – places in the story & game claim to increase max AP, but they don't actually.

-- Alliances, a bad move at mp3 – questionable at mp4. Don't rush into it. Research.

-- Citizenship. Learn about ALL the lands first – you will have to convince the King of your choice that you know what you're asking for to get in.

GAME RULES AND DOCUMENTATION:

The following things in the documentation are WRONG and so I don't consider them a spoiler to alert you about them:

The regen clock timer is almost NEVER right. Always hit F5 before looking at the timer, especially if you want your temporary stat boost to last more than a few seconds.

When the real-world clock hits the top of the hour, all your edit sessions of papers or PM are flushed. Save your work on your own computer, and watch the clock.

Definition of Victorious is not rigorously correct – as written it ignores lifestealer effects.

HC Rules change faster than the documentation can keep up. Believe nothing. Test.

Lifesteal has been capped at 20%, regardless of power.

Broken Pattern Puzzle – don't use Internet Explorer to solve it – generates a crash and you don't get the wonderful prize. Firefox works.

The PM alert does not always sound, or sounds once for two messages. Check for unread messages often.

If you have messages saved in the cloud sorting device, you can't see them if you sort all messages out from your in-box – it gives you the "empty" message. Many old messages scroll off the bottom of the inbox and can't be seen unless you delete ones above it.

HOW TO BE AN ADEPT:
If you click on the compass rose on the right hand edge, below day's achievements and the current honor rating, there is a box where you can type one person's name and choose to be their adept. It costs you nothing, and can be changed at any time. It puts a little flag below where your avatar would be saying who you are an adept of.

An mp5 needs to sign up 30 active adepts to be allowed to go to MP6, thus we have a big incentive to help you learn the game and succeed, so that you stay active. This means answering lots of questions! Please read below for the most frequent concerns.

What you should know about Head Contest that you will probabelly don't learn in any other place:

-If HC is close to christimas, maybe you should prefer to win the second or third place in November than the first place next year, because the credits reward help to buy new creatures available only in christimas and stats reward is only worth few months of trainning.

-It's more easy beat people with very high stats (specially VE) than people who use a lot of tokens.

-It's very common weak players defeat people that you thought that you're unable to defeat (it's your fault in this case).

-There are a fight penality for people with a lot of heads, this penality affect more people with high stats than people with lots of tokens. Then, if you can hide, you should hide no matter how stronght you are.

-You will logout (lose heads and scores) if you're idle for more than 6 hours. That's right, you cannot sleep more than 6 hours during HC :D

-You will have advantage if you start to play since from the begin of HC.

-Use time and space in your benefit. Learn where are the best places to hide, when your "enemy" play and when your "enemy" is idle. Sometimes, one "enemy" that attack during the day learn one place where you hide, other that play during the night don't know this place. Take advantage from this fact and exchange that place where you hide, if possible.

-Put your "enemy" in your friend's list to know when he/she play.

-Your friends can help you, but you cannot use alternative accounts to help you.
